Templates Angular2模板集类取决于标记属性
有没有办法根据标记的属性在标记中设置类? 目前我正在构建一个树视图,并希望根据树是否打开来设置glypicon箭头。 我用的是引导折叠,所以语法是这样的Templates Angular2模板集类取决于标记属性,templates,angular,Templates,Angular,有没有办法根据标记的属性在标记中设置类? 目前我正在构建一个树视图,并希望根据树是否打开来设置glypicon箭头。 我用的是引导折叠,所以语法是这样的 <a data-toggle="collapse" href="#someElementId"><span class="glyphicon-arrow-left"></a> 未展开时-标记具有class=“collapsed”和属性aria expanded='false' 有没有办法根据类的父属性或
<a data-toggle="collapse" href="#someElementId"><span class="glyphicon-arrow-left"></a>
未展开时-标记具有class=“collapsed”和属性aria expanded='false'
有没有办法根据类的父属性或类在范围内不使用javascript的情况下在范围内设置类
差不多
<a data-toggle="collapse" class='collapsed' href="#someElementId"><span class="[parent.class]=='collapsed'?glyphicon-arrow-left:glyphicon-arrow-down"></a>
???您可以尝试以下方法:
<a data-toggle="collapse" #parent class='collapsed' href="#someElementId">
<span [ngClass]="{'glyphicon-arrow-left': parent.nativeElement.className=='collapsed', 'glyphicon-arrow-down': parent.nativeElement.className!='collapsed'">
(...)
</span>
</a>
您可以尝试以下方法:
<a data-toggle="collapse" #parent class='collapsed' href="#someElementId">
<span [ngClass]="{'glyphicon-arrow-left': parent.nativeElement.className=='collapsed', 'glyphicon-arrow-down': parent.nativeElement.className!='collapsed'">
(...)
</span>
</a>
类应该依赖的属性是什么?它可能依赖于aria扩展属性,例如,它可能依赖于类。类应该依赖的属性是什么?它可能依赖于aria扩展属性,例如,它可能依赖于类